Yes, high rock lake nutrient reopener Does permit have instream monitoring? no Few expiration date: Sep 30, 2028 Facility Summary Wilks County Schools operate Boomer Ferguson Elementary School which houses 215 students and faculty that has a minor WWTP with a design capacity of 0.003 MGD. The permit for this facility was originally issues in 1989. • Septic tank • Dosing tank • Two surface sand filters • Calcium hypochlorite disinfection • Sodium sulfite dechlorination Renewal Summary This renewal contains the following changes: • Updated the effluent table in Section A. (mg/1) 35.8 2.3 *2B .0404 (c) Applies Total Residual Chlorine 1. Cap Daily Max limit at 28 ug/I to protect for acute toxicity Ammonia (as NH3-N) 1. If Allowable Conc > 35 mg/l, Monitor Only 2. Monthly Avg limit x 3 = Weekly Avg limit (Municipals) 3. Monthly Avg limit x 5 = Daily Max limit (Non-Munis) If the allowable ammonia concentration is > 35 mg/L, no limit shall be imposed By Policy dischargers < 1 MGD get limits no lower than 2 & 4 due to BAT * From 2B .0404(c) - Winter Limits can be no less stringent than 2 times the summer limits Fecal Coliform 1.
